PerfecTress Colour College only works with hydrogen peroxide in the
European measurements (percent). In particular only 6% and 9% are the
only strengths used for bleaching or colouring. Thereby, ensuring no
chemical damage to the hair from either process,
When permanently colouring hair:
Mix with 6% for the same base shade; or one shade lift.
Mix with 9% for two shades lift.
i.e.
To colour base shade 6 to a 6.1 use 6%.
To colour base shade 6 to a 5/ 4/ 3/ 2/ 1 use 6%.
To colour base shade 6 to a 7.1 use 6%.
To colour base shade 6 to a 8.1 use 9%.
